I have a grandson that got hooked on the fly. I set up a ultra light outfit for him with a clear bobber with a fly drop. Now he wants to move up to the real thing. A 9 foot rod seems to long for him to handle anybody got any recomdations for a smaller rod (he is nine years old) Say like a 7"6". He also hooked on tying I think I have the worlds supply of buggers.

Hey! Very cool to get him going... if you are looking for something in a rod only I would recommend a St. Croix 3 weight at 7'6". It is a great value rod and has all of the qualities that you would begin looking for in more expensive rods. Besides, if he doesn't like fishing you've got a nifty little creekin' rod for those brushy 50 cfs favorites you've got hidden up your sleeve.
